On the NOVA processing scale, Canadian Bacon, Egg & Cheddar On An English Muffin is classified as Group 4 (Ultra-processed). NOVA measures industrial processing intensity rather than ingredient-level safety, so it complements the SAFFA and CSPI ratings: a product can be clean on additive flags but heavily processed, or lightly processed but carry individually flagged ingredients. Combining both lenses gives a fuller picture than either alone.

Full Ingredient List
English muffin (unbleached enriched flour {wheat flour, malted barley flour, niacin, reduced iron, thiamin mononitrate, riboflavin, folic acid}, water, yeast, sugar, wheat gluten, calcium sulfate, sea salt, diacetyl tartaric acid esters of monoglycerides, corn meal, fumaric acid, lactic acid, calcium peroxide, calcium propionate {to retard spoilage}, ascorbic acid), whole egg patty (whole eggs, whey, nonfat milk, vegetable oil {corn and/or soybean oil}, contains 2% or less of the following: salt, xanthan gum, citric acid, pepper, natural butter flavor), cheddar cheese (grade a pasteurized milk, cultures, salt, enzymes, and annatto color), fully cooked canadian bacon (pork sirloin hips, cured with water, sugar, salt, contains 2% or less of: sodium lactate, sodium phosphate, natural smoke flavor, natural flavoring, sodium diacetate, sodium erythorbate, sodium nitrite).
